The size of St Albans is approximately 13.0 square kilometres. It has 36 parks covering nearly 8.4% of total area. The population of St Albans in 2016 was 37309 people. By 2021 the population was 38042 showing a population growth of 2.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in St Albans is 20-29 years. Households in St Albans are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in St Albans work in a labourer occupation.In 2021, 59.10% of the homes in St Albans were owner-occupied compared with 60.50% in 2016.
St Albans has 17,234 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in St Albans have seen a 17.26%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 18.60% increase. As at 28 February 2026:
